Regional Metamorphism - Geology In

Regional metamorphism occurs when rocks are buried deep in the crust. This is commonly associated with convergent plate boundaries and the formation of mountain ranges. Because burial to 10 km to 20 km is required, the areas affected tend to be large. Most regional metamorphism takes place within continental crust.

Metamorphic rock - Regional metamorphism | Britannica

Regional metamorphism. Regional metamorphism is associated with the major events of Earth dynamics, and the vast majority of metamorphic rocks are so produced.They are the rocks involved in the cyclic processes of erosion, sedimentation, burial, metamorphism, and mountain building (), events that are all related to major convective processes in Earth’s mantle.

Geological Society - Regional

Regional metamorphism affects large volumes (regions) of rock, especially in the mountain chains that form when continents collide. Regionally metamorphosed rocks usually have a squashed, or foliated appearance – examples include slate, schist and gneiss (pronounced “nice”), formed by metamorphism of mudstones, and also marble which is formed by metamorphism of limestone.

Metamorphic rock - Zeolite facies | Britannica

Metamorphic rock - Metamorphic rock - Zeolite facies: In the zeolite facies, sediments and volcanic debris show the first major response to burial. Reactions are often not complete, and typical metamorphic fabrics may be poorly developed or not developed at all. This is the facies of burial metamorphism. The zeolite facies was first described from southern New Zealand, but similar rocks have ...

Metamorphic Rocks | Geology

Metamorphic rock fall into two categories, foliated and unfoliated. Most foliated metamorphic rocks originate from regional metamorphism. Some unfoliated metamorphic rocks, such as hornfels, originate only by contact metamorphism, but others can originate either by contact metamorphism or by regional metamorphism.

Types of metamorphism - The Australian Museum

Regional metamorphism. Most metamorphic rocks occur in fold mountain belts or cratonic areas. Such rocks cover large areas of the Earth's crust and are therefore termed regional metamorphic rocks. They arise by the combined action of heat, burial pressure, differential stress, strain and fluids on pre-existing rocks.

Contact Metamorphism : What is Contact …

Contact Metamorphism Contact Metamorphism. Contact metamorphism is a type of metamorphism that occurs adjacent to intrusive igneous rocks due to temperature increases resulting from hot magma intrusion into the rock. The metamorphosed zone is known as the metamorphic aureole around an igneous rock.
